About the Role Vibrant Building Technologies is looking for a versatile Lab and Manufacturing Technician to join our team in Ridgefield, CT. This role sits at the intersection of product development and early-stage production. You will work directly with our engineering team on testing, validation, and prototyping, and you will also play an active role in assembling early production units, helping us build quality and efficiency into our manufacturing process from the ground up. We are open to candidates at various experience levels, including recent graduates. If you are early in your career and have strong mechanical aptitude, a willingness to learn, and genuine enthusiasm for hands-on technical work, we want to hear from you. You will be working alongside a team of highly experienced engineers and operations professionals across disciplines who are genuinely invested in developing the people around them. This is a real opportunity to absorb deep technical knowledge, learn the full product development and manufacturing cycle, and grow into a broader role over time. The right person for this role is comfortable moving between a test bench and an assembly station, takes pride in the quality of their work regardless of the task, and understands that feedback from the production floor is just as valuable as data from the lab. Key Responsibilities Lab and Testing
  • Execute hands-on functional and performance testing on HVAC-related systems and components, following defined test plans and procedures
  • Set up and operate data acquisition (DAQ) systems to capture, log, and review test data including temperature, pressure, airflow, and electrical measurements
  • Analyze and summarize test results, identifying anomalies and communicating findings clearly to the engineering team
  • Build and iterate on physical prototypes in support of product development and engineering validation efforts
  • Maintain and calibrate lab instrumentation and test equipment to ensure measurement accuracy
  • Document test procedures, results, and observations accurately in lab notebooks and digital records Production Assembly and Manufacturing Support
  • Perform hands-on assembly of early production units across VibrantBT product lines, following work instructions and assembly documentation
  • Identify and report assembly issues, fit problems, or process inefficiencies, providing direct feedback to engineering and operations
  • Help develop and refine assembly procedures and work instructions based on firsthand build experience
  • Support end-of-line testing and quality checks as products move through initial production runs
  • Collaborate with engineers and operations staff to improve build quality, reduce assembly time, and catch issues before they scale
  • Assist with facility maintenance, inventory organization, and general manufacturing floor tasks as needed Required Qualifications
  • Hands-on technical experience in a lab, manufacturing, shop, or classroom environment, whether through work history, internships, coursework, or personal projects. Recent graduates are welcome to apply.
  • Mechanical aptitude with a demonstrated ability to assemble, adjust, and troubleshoot physical systems or products
  • Comfortable using common hand tools, power tools, and precision measurement instruments
  • Basic familiarity with electrical concepts such as reading wiring diagrams, using a multimeter, and working safely around low-voltage systems
  • Ability to read or a strong willingness to learn how to interpret schematics, wiring diagrams, and engineering drawings
  • Strong attention to detail and a disciplined approach to documentation
  • Willingness to shift between lab work and production assembly based on team needs
  • Curiosity and eagerness to learn from experienced engineers and take on new responsibilities over time Preferred Qualifications
  • Associate degree, technical certification, or coursework in HVAC, electrical technology, mechanical engineering technology, or a related field
  • Working knowledge of HVAC systems, components, or principles
  • Prior experience with data acquisition systems and instrumentation
  • Familiarity with UL, CSA, or similar product safety standards and certification processes
  • Exposure to PCB-level assembly or basic electronics troubleshooting
  • Experience in an product development Test/ R D lab, or contract manufacturing environment Work Environment This is a full-time, on-site position at our Ridgefield, CT facility.
The role involves regular work across both lab and light manufacturing environments, including standing, lifting, and sustained hands-on assembly work. You will interact daily with engineers and operations staff, and occasionally with external vendors and certification teams.
